Clinched!

TACOMA, Wash. – Saturday afternoon's 8-1 victory over host Pacific Lutheran University clinched the regular-season Northwest Conference title for Whitman College's women's tennis team. The Missionaries' Courtney Lawless, Morgan Lawless, Allie Wallin and Alexandra Sigouin each won twice during the match against the Lutes on their home courts.

Saturday's victory lifts Whitman to 11-0 in the league, and 14-5 overall, with one NWC match remaining. The Lutes fall to 7-8 overall and 3-8 in the conference.

Dominating doubles play previewed the final verdict Saturday as Whitman swept through three PLU pairings. Wallin and Sigouin earned the first point with an 8-4 triumph at No. 2, followed by the tandem of Lindsey Brodeck and Jenna Gilbert's 8-3 win at 3-doubles. Soon after the 3's were finished the No. 1 pairing of the Lawless sisters completed their 8-2 win over the Lutes' top team of Caroline Dreher and Samantha Lund.

Now only two points away from clinching not only the match victory but also the regular season crown, the Missionaries added those points with singles wins by, first, Wallin at No. 4 and then Morgan Lawless at No. 3. Wallin steam rolled PLU's Megan Beyers -- half of the pairing that had fallen to Wallin and Sigouin at 2-doubles -- in straight sets, 6-2 and 6-1, and Lawless roared past Lund by a pair of 6-2 scores.

Any celebration had to wait, though, with four more matches still on the courts.

Jenna Dobrin at No. 2 and Courtney Lawless at No. 1 kept the streak rolling with straight-set victories before PLU's Emily Bower would tussle with Whitman's Lindsey Brodeck into a super-tiebreaker third set. Bower had captured the opening set but Brodeck won the second by a commanding 6-1 margin. The two went nearly point for point in the tiebreaker with Bower finally outlasting Brodeck by a 14-12 count for the Lutes' lone victory on the day.

That left Sigouin and Emily Beemsterboer on the courts in the final match, but the results weren't long in coming as Sigouin pounded out a 6-4, 6-3 win to close out the day.

The 2015 NWC tournament will be hosted by the Missionaries for the second consecutive season. Whitman's men on Friday clinched the NWC regular season title as well meaning both postseason tournaments will be played on the Whitman courts. The women's tournament is scheduled for Friday and Saturday in Walla Walla. The winners of Friday's semifinal matches advance into Saturday morning's championship match.
